Experiencing Flexibility Training

For this discussion you will experience a type of flexibility training and reflect on your experience.

To begin, select one of these practices: Tai Chi, Yoga, or Pilates. Describe the benefits of your chosen practice and explain its relationship to wellness.

Then, engage in one of these activities by taking a course at your local gym, a recreation center, or a private studio. If you do not have access to a live class, you may find a digital alternative such as a class from a website, the on-demand channel on TV, a fitness video game, or a DVD. Be creative in finding a class. You may also check your local library for videos.

Next, examine your experience with flexibility training by describing the session, the setting, and three exercises within the session.

Which muscles did these three exercises address? You must use the correct medical terminology for the muscles used in each exercise.

Would you continue to incorporate these exercises into your ongoing flexibility training?

Examine the relationship between flexibility training and wellness by rating your stress level and muscle tension before and after the session on a scale of 1 to 10 (with 10 being the highest).

Explain any differences you may have felt physically or mentally after the session.

Your initial post must be a minimum of 250 words. Use at least one scholarly reference properly cited and referenced according to APA style as outlined.
